Why It Matters

The program equips U.S. travel advisors with deeper product knowledge and ready‑to‑use marketing assets, directly driving higher revenue for both advisors and Audley Travel. It strengthens the partnership ecosystem in a competitive, experience‑focused travel market.

Key Takeaways

  • Audley Academy launches online advisor training program
  • Graduates become accredited Audley Ambassadors with toolkit
  • Ambassadors receive $100 gift card and monthly updates
  • Early graduates eligible for 2027 FAM trip lottery
  • Program aims to boost advisors' revenue and product knowledge

Pulse Analysis

The travel‑advisor landscape is shifting toward hyper‑personalized, tailor‑made experiences, and agencies are scrambling for tools that translate expertise into sales. Audley Travel’s new Audley Academy answers that demand by delivering a structured, online curriculum that deepens destination knowledge while providing practical resources. By certifying advisors as Audley Ambassadors, the company creates a recognizable brand endorsement that can be leveraged in client communications, boosting credibility and conversion rates.

Beyond education, the Academy bundles a robust sales‑and‑marketing toolkit—website banners, blog templates, press releases, and social media assets—designed to streamline promotional efforts. The $100 bonus gift card and exclusive access to upcoming FAM trips serve as tangible incentives, encouraging rapid program adoption. Monthly newsletters keep ambassadors informed of new excursions and destination launches, ensuring they remain at the forefront of market trends and can offer fresh, sell‑able experiences to clients.
